Volleyball falls short in three-set battle
09.08.2023 | Women's Volleyball
CHARLOTTE, N.C. – The UNC Asheville volleyball team kicked off the Queens Fall Classic Friday evening against The Citadel and fell in three sets (25-20, 25-22, 25-20).
With Friday's loss, the Bulldogs drop to 3-5, while The Citadel moves to 8-0.
HOW IT HAPPENED
Both teams exchanged back-and-forth blows to start the match, as The Citadel jumped out to a 4-2 lead before Asheville went on a 5-1 run to take the lead 7-5. Asheville's first three points came from kills by Albertine van der Goot, Baylor Herlehy, and Matilde Teixeira.
Asheville extended its lead 8-6 before The Citadel went on a 6-0 run to jump ahead 12-8. Asheville would bring the score back within one, following a kill from Teixeira (17-16), but that was as close as The Citadel would allow the Bulldogs, as they went on to take the first set and take a 1-0 lead.
The Citadel opened the second set on a 4-0 run before Asheville answered with a 4-0 run of their own. A kill from van der Goot would get the Bulldogs on the board, and three errors from The Citadel would help Asheville even the score. The Citadel would go on to score back-to-back points to take a 7-5 lead and hold the lead, until a kill from Herlehy and an error from The Citadel, would tie the score at 11. Once again, The Citadel would respond with back-to-back points to retake the lead, but the Bulldogs never trailed by more than three points.
With The Citadel leading 18-15, Asheville brought the score back within one, following a kill from Kylie Cackovic and a block from Sydney Bradley, but The Citadel responded with a 4-0 run, earning their largest lead of the night (22-17). The Bulldogs would bring the score back within three, but The Citadel answered with the next two points, taking it to set point (24-19).
Asheville would not go down without a fight, as the Bulldogs went on to cut the score back down to two points following back-to-back Citadel errors and an ace from Ona Elkins, but a kill from The Citadel's Ali Ruffin would secure the second set victory.
In the final set of the evening, The Citadel jumped out to a 5-2 start and never looked back as they held the lead for the rest of the match. Asheville never trailed by more than three points early on, but an 8-2 run by The Citadel helped earn them their largest lead of the set at 21-14.
The Bulldogs once again attempted to pull off a late set comeback, as they went on a 4-0 run to make the score 23-20, but The Citadel would close out the match with back-to-back kills to earn the sweep.
IN THE BOX
Herlehy led Asheville at the net with a season-high seven blocks and added on six kills. Van der Goot also recorded six kills and added to her stat line four blocks, five digs, and a season-high 14 assists. Texiera nearly recorded a double-double as she finished the night with nine kills, nine digs, and three aces. Katie Nichols led Asheville's defense with 10 digs.
